[QUOTE="Tom Cashel, post: 454352, member: 321"] Again, the spell gives no provision for safety valves like being "shunted" back into the receptacle. It is [i]very clear[/i] about what happens if you're foolish enough to be in that summoned monster when it "disappears" back to where it came from. The spell only says that you can [b]attack[/b] (possess) creatures on the same plane. Once you're in the body, it works "as polymorph other." So I would say that if you choose to stay in the summoned monster (and it would be an easy thing to shift back into the receptacle), then you "disappear" when the summoning spell ends. If you can't get back to within range of your receptacle before the magic jar ends, you die, per the spell. Keep in mind that the caster probably has at least 8 hrs. to figure out a way to do this... Nobody said it wasn't a dangerous proposition, severing your own soul from its body. [/QUOTE]
